Maeve Vallely Bartlett is the former Massachusetts Secretary of Energy and Environmental Affairs. Bartlett was appointed by Gov. Deval Patrick in 2014.

Prior to her appointment, Bartlett served in various capacities within state government including assistant secretary of transportation planning and EEA general counsel. She also worked as senior enforcement council with the U.S. Environmental Protection Agency.[1]

Political career

Secretary of Energy and Environmental Affairs (2014–2015)

Bartlett was appointed by Gov. Deval Patrick and sworn into office June 9, 2014.[2] She replaced Richard Sullivan, who left the position to serve as the governor's chief of staff.[3]
